Understanding Siemens PLC Code Libraries

Siemens PLC code libraries are collections of pre-written code that facilitate programming tasks within Siemens PLC environments. These libraries contain function blocks, data types, and other code snippets that can be reused across different projects. By leveraging these libraries, programmers can save significant time, as they do not have to write every piece of code from scratch. The benefits of utilizing these libraries extend beyond mere convenience; they also enhance code quality and consistency, which are critical in industrial applications where reliability is paramount. Additionally, many libraries are designed to comply with industry standards, ensuring that your code meets necessary regulatory requirements.

Types of Siemens PLC Code Libraries

There are several types of Siemens PLC code libraries available, each catering to different programming needs. Standard libraries offer a versatile set of functions that can be used in a variety of applications, making them ideal for general programming tasks. Custom libraries, on the other hand, are tailored to specific processes or machines, allowing for greater optimization and efficiency in targeted applications. For specialized needs, application-specific libraries provide functions designed for particular industries or tasks, such as automotive or food processing. Understanding these distinctions is crucial, as selecting the appropriate library can greatly enhance the effectiveness of your automation projects.

Where to Find Siemens PLC Code Libraries

Finding Siemens PLC code libraries involves navigating various platforms and online communities. Many software vendors offer libraries for purchase directly through their websites, providing a straightforward way to acquire these resources. Additionally, online forums and communities dedicated to automation often share libraries, either for free or at a nominal cost. It’s essential to ensure that the source you choose is reputable; unreliable libraries can lead to costly errors down the line. Engaging with community members can also provide insights into the most effective libraries for your specific needs, making it easier to make informed decisions.

Considerations When Choosing Libraries

When selecting Siemens PLC code libraries, several key factors should be taken into account. Compatibility is paramount; ensure that the library is designed to work seamlessly with your existing software and hardware. Additionally, evaluate the ease of use; a well-documented library with intuitive functions will minimize the learning curve for your team. Support and documentation are also crucial; libraries that come with comprehensive guides and responsive customer service can save you time and frustration in troubleshooting. Finally, consider community feedback and reviews; other users’ experiences can provide valuable insights that help you avoid potential pitfalls.

Benefits of Using Siemens PLC Code Libraries

The advantages of utilizing Siemens PLC code libraries are manifold. One of the most significant benefits is time savings; by reusing proven code, teams can accelerate project timelines and allocate resources more efficiently. Improved code quality is another critical advantage; libraries that adhere to best practices reduce the risk of bugs and enhance reliability. Furthermore, these libraries foster collaboration within teams by providing a common framework that all members can work from, ultimately leading to better outcomes in projects. By integrating these libraries into your workflow, you can elevate your programming capabilities and drive innovation within your organization.